Thomas Hardy: The Time-torn Man Book

Thomas Hardy is one of the sacred figures in English writing a great poet and a novelist with a world reputation. His life was also extraordinary: from the poverty of rural Dorset he went on to become the Grand Old Man of English life and letters his last resting place in Westminster Abbey. This seminal biography by our leading biographer covers Hardy's illegitimate birth his rural upbringing his escape to London in the 1860s his marriages his status as a bestselling novelist and in later life his supreme achievements as a poet.Read More
